Finance Review Summary — Second-Source Supplier Search

For sales leads: the search for a second-source supplier of the Quillard valve assemblies is underway. Three candidates shortlisted; two are cost-competitive with our current sole supplier, Ostrev Metals, and one offers shorter lead times at a premium. Qualification testing runs through next quarter. Until a second source is approved, keep delivery promises conservative on valve-dependent orders. Pricing implications are summarised in the confidential note below.

internal memo for kawip-hadug: Headcount on the Wenwyn team goes from 7 to 140 by the end of January. Gross margin on Wenwyn came in at 20 percent against a plan of 15 percent.

## Changelog — Font vendoring defaults changed

As of this release, the Bracken UI build no longer fetches third-party fonts at build time. All typefaces used by the Lanternwell suite are now vendored into the repo under a dedicated assets directory, and the fetch step is skipped by default. If you're onboarding, nothing to install — the fonts travel with the checkout. The build flags controlling this behavior are listed below.

settings of hadup-yafog:
LAMAEL_PIN=3761
LAMAEL_TENANT=istmir
LAMAEL_METRICS_HOST=metrics.lamael.plorvasys.test
LAMAEL_SEAL=seal_8ea68500
LAMAEL_STANDBY_TEAM=fraok

Handover for review: Brackenbuild migration, phase two. I've converted the Lanternfish service's Makefile targets into hermetic Brackenbuild rules; all third-party deps are now pinned in the lockfile and fetched through the vendored mirror. Please verify the remote-cache config — cache poisoning was our main worry, so artifacts are content-addressed and signed. One loose end: the bootstrap toolchain still needs a sealed credentials bundle on first build. To unseal that bundle on a fresh machine, use the passphrase below.

strongbox words: joreth-sileth-zorok-quenax-novix